iPad is good for Microsoft

The iPad may be just what Microsoft needed. The hard to gain traction Silverlight initiative may be the recipient of increased momentum due to the iPad.

Job’s concerns about the Adobe flash product may be legitimate.iPad Vs Flash: Jobs Calls Adobe Lazy

Sometime ago I switched my home computer from Adobe’s free PDF reader to Foxit simply because I was tired of all the startup processes adobe chucked in to the computer. As well as the update process itself since version 6 really made updates more intrusive.

Foxit is lightweight easy to use with tabbed documents little update notification and fast for simple PDF viewing.

So, with Silverlight so far failing to replace Flash for websites this might be the snowball start Microsoft needed.
